Styx River electromagnetic and magnetic airborne geophysical survey data compilation

This geophysical survey is located in the upper South Fork Kuskokwim River and Skwentna river drainages, southcentral Alaska. The Styx River survey is in the Yentna and McGrath mining districts, about 150 kilometers northwest of Anchorage, Alaska. Frequency domain electromagnetic and magnetic data were collected with the DIGHEM system from October 16th to November 12th, 2007 and from March 21st to April 22nd, 2008. A total of 5338.6 line-kilometers were collected covering 1859.3 square kilometers. Line spacing was 400 meters (m). Data were collected 30 m above the ground surface from a helicopter towed sensor platform ('bird') on a 30 m long line.
